运维

运维

Products

当前位置:首页 > 运维 >

集群服务器和分布式服务器有什么不同之处呢?

96SEO 2025-04-27 02:07 2



一、背景与问题引入

在现代IT架构中,集群和分布式系统是提高系统性能和可靠性的关键技术。因为数据量和业务复杂性的增长,如何有效部署和管理这些架构成为关键问题。本文将深入探讨集群与分布式架构的原理、实现方式及其在性能优化中的应用。

二、集群与分析分因成布式架构的典型表现与成因分析

在集群架构中,多个服务器协同工作,共同处理相同的任务,如MySQL集群通过读写分离和负载均衡技术降低单台服务器的压力。而在分布式架构中,任务被分解成多个子任务,分别在不同的服务器上并行处理,如分布式数据库解决方案。

集群服务器和分布式服务器的区别是什么?

集群和分布式架构的典型表现和成因如下: - 集群多台服务器提供相同服务,共享资源,提高可用性和容错性。 - 分布式任务分解,并行处理,提高计算能力和处理能力。

三、集群与分布式架构的优化策略

针对集群和分布式架构,以下优化策略可用于提升系统性能:

1. 分布式架构优化
  • 工作原理将任务分解为多个子任务,并行处理。
  • 技术实现使用分布式计算框架,如MapReduce。
  • 案例Hadoop分布式文件系统通过节点间的数据复制提高数据可靠性。
  • 实施建议合理划分任务粒度,选择合适的分布式计算框架。
2. 集群架构优化
  • 工作原理多台服务器协同处理相同任务,共享资源。
  • 技术实现负载均衡、故障转移等。
  • 案例使用LVS实现负载均衡,提高服务器的响应速度。
  • 实施建议合理配置服务器资源,优化负载均衡策略。

四、效果

通过实施上述优化策略,集群和分布式架构在特定环境下的性能得到了显著提升。以下建议有助于选择合适的优化策略组合:

  1. 根据业务需求选择架构对于需要高可用性和容错性的场景,选择集群架构;对于需要高性能计算和大规模数据处理,选择分布式架构。
  2. 持续监控与优化建立持续的性能监控体系,根据实际情况调整优化策略。
  3. 结合实际案例与数据通过实际案例和数据验证优化效果,确保系统始终保持最优状态。

集群与分布式架构在提高系统性能和可靠性方面具有重要意义。通过深入理解其原理和实现方式,结合实际案例与数据,我们可以选择合适的优化策略,实现系统性能的持续提升。


提交需求或反馈

Demand feedback